Tips for Using Beauty Dishes to Create Soft, Flattering Light

If you’re looking for a way to create soft, flattering light for your portrait photography, then you should definitely consider using a beauty dish. Beauty dishes are a great tool for creating a unique, soft light that can really make your subjects look their best. Here are some tips for using beauty dishes to create soft, flattering light.

1. Use a Diffuser – A diffuser is a great way to soften the light from your beauty dish. You can either use a fabric diffuser or a diffusion panel. This will help to spread the light out more evenly and create a softer, more flattering look.

2. Move the Dish Closer – Moving the beauty dish closer to your subject will help to create a softer light. The closer the dish is to your subject, the softer the light will be.

3. Use a Grid – A grid will help to control the spread of light from your beauty dish. This will help to create a more focused light that is less likely to spill onto the background.

4. Use a Reflector – A reflector can be used to bounce light back onto your subject. This will help to fill in any shadows and create a more even light.

5. Experiment – Don’t be afraid to experiment with different angles and distances. You may be surprised at the different looks you can create with your beauty dish.

How to Use Beauty Dishes to Create Dramatic Lighting Effects

If you’re looking to create dramatic lighting effects in your photography, then you should definitely consider using a beauty dish. Beauty dishes are a type of light modifier that can be used to create a unique and dramatic look in your photos.

So, what is a beauty dish? A beauty dish is a round, shallow bowl-shaped light modifier that is used to create a soft, yet directional light. It’s typically used to create a more dramatic look in portraits, as it creates a soft light that wraps around the subject’s face.

When using a beauty dish, you’ll want to position it close to your subject. This will create a more dramatic look, as the light will be more focused and intense. You can also adjust the angle of the beauty dish to create different lighting effects. For example, if you angle the beauty dish slightly above your subject, you’ll create a more dramatic look with more shadows.

Another great way to use a beauty dish is to use it in combination with other light modifiers. For example, you can use a beauty dish as your main light, and then use a softbox or umbrella to fill in the shadows. This will create a more balanced look with softer shadows.

Finally, you can also use a beauty dish to create a rim light. To do this, you’ll want to position the beauty dish behind your subject and slightly to the side. This will create a rim of light around your subject, which can be used to create a more dramatic look.

Q&A

1. What is a beauty dish?
A beauty dish is a type of lighting modifier used in photography that produces a soft, even light with a slightly higher contrast than a softbox. It is typically used for portrait and glamour photography.

2. How does a beauty dish work?
A beauty dish works by reflecting light off of a curved surface and then through a diffuser. This creates a soft, even light that is slightly higher in contrast than a softbox.

3. What are the benefits of using a beauty dish?
The main benefit of using a beauty dish is that it produces a soft, even light with a slightly higher contrast than a softbox. This makes it ideal for portrait and glamour photography.
